But he did a damn good job writing "The Heist," an excellent account of the Lufthansa heist that should be of interest to any Goodfellas fans. Absolutely. Cummings and Volkman did a great job there, especially their description of what happened to Theresa Ferrara, which was largely left out by Hill over the years (and should give mob apologists pause, but that's neither here nor there). But overall, I agree with the consensus here. Volkman doesn't come across as very likable, and the shoddy job he did with "Gangbusters" hurts his credibility more than anything else.

This excerpt was published in Gangland on 1/4/1999
"Last year in Gang Land was either the year of the stool pigeon or the year of the jailbird. Take your pick. It doesn't matter. These birds of the same feather are getting harder to tell apart through their sheer stupidity. Speaking of sheer stupidity, we start our look at the past year by presenting Gang Land's first annual Ernest Volkman award to John Lombardi. The Volkie, we're sad to say, will be an annual award to the so-called journalist who makes the most mistakes and comes up with the most unadulterated drivel in one article, book, or television appearance or who consistently exhibits the wretched and pathetic journalistic non-skills of Ernest Volkman".
In his awful book, "Gangbusters," Volkman, (Gang Land, Nov. 2) made so many factual errors that you'd need a computer and a couple of cyber geeks to count them. Under a threat of a lawsuit from a couple of gangsters, Volkman, his publisher, and Penthouse Magazine -- which printed excerpts from the book -- had to publicly fess up to the erroneous drivel.
